6:2 ftoh-gluc
- Other Name: 6:2 Fluorotelomer alcohol glucuronide
- InChIKey: QGCRDEVAWUFVFN-UQGZVRACSA-N
- InChI: InChI=1S/C14H13F13O7/c15-9(16,1-2-33-8-5(30)3(28)4(29)6(34-8)7(31)32)10(17,18)11(19,20)12(21,22)13(23,24)14(25,26)27/h3-6,8,28-30H,1-2H2,(H,31,32)/t3-,4-,5+,6-,8+/m0/s1
- SMILES: C(CO[C@H]1[C@@H]([C@H]([C@@H]([C@H](O1)C(=O)O)O)O)O)C(C(C(C(C(C(F)(F)F)(F)F)(F)F)(F)F)(F)F)(F)F
- Exact Mass: 540.04537
- Molecular Formula: C14H13F13O7

Hidden Reactions Filter
Some biological reactions link very small precursors (e.g. CO₂, acetate) to much larger products.
These reactions are correct, but they can create unrealistic shortest paths and connect otherwise separate parts of the graph.
To keep the overview readable, FAIR-TPs hides six such reactions where a <60 Da precursor leads to a >300 Da product in the visualisations.
You can have all these paths in the download output.

Hidden reaction pairs (precursor → product):
- Acetate → N-(2-benzoyl-4-chlorophenyl)-2-acetamidoacetamide
- Acetate → N-(2-benzoyl-4-chlorophenyl)-2-acetamido-n-methylacetamide
- Carbon dioxide → Formylmethanofuran
- Acrolein → Chembl3706542
- Ethylene oxide → Acetyl-coa
- Formaldehyde → S-hydroxymethylglutathione
